Macandrew Bay is located in New Zealand, specifically within the Dunedin City district on the South Island, at GPS coordinates -45.86667, 170.6. This small coastal suburb is situated along the eastern shore of Otago Harbour, providing scenic views and access to the water. Macandrew Bay is known for its picturesque landscapes, recreational activities, and a close-knit community atmosphere.
The area is popular for water sports, such as sailing and kayaking, and offers various walking tracks that highlight the natural beauty of the coastline. Attractions and Activities in Macandrew Bay
Macandrew Bay is a small coastal community located on the Otago Peninsula in New Zealand. This picturesque area is known for its stunning natural scenery, characterized by rolling hills, beaches, and views of the surrounding waters. The bay itself offers a tranquil setting, making it a popular spot for kayaking, sailing, and other water-based activities.
The nearby beaches provide opportunities for swimming and relaxation, all while enjoying the scenic beauty of the region. The Otago Peninsula is rich in wildlife and natural attractions, including the nearby Royal Albatross Centre and various walking trails that showcase the unique flora and fauna of the area. Cultural highlights include local art galleries and community events that reflect the close-knit nature of the Bay’s residents.
Additionally, the region’s history is intertwined with the MΔori and European settlements, offering a glimpse into its diverse past. Overall, Macandrew Bay serves as a peaceful retreat that highlights the natural beauty and cultural significance of the Otago Peninsula.
Practical Information for Visitors
Macandrew Bay is located near Dunedin, making it easily accessible by various modes of transport. The nearest major airport is Dunedin Airport, which is about a 30-minute drive from the bay. Public buses connect Dunedin to nearby areas, and from the city, you can take a short taxi or rideshare to reach Macandrew Bay.
The region is also well-served by local roads, making it ideal for those traveling by car. The climate in Macandrew Bay is characterized by cool summers and mild winters. Average summer temperatures hover around 20 degrees Celsius, while winters can drop to around 5 degrees Celsius.
The best time to visit is during the summer months from December to February when you can enjoy pleasant weather and outdoor activities. When visiting Macandrew Bay, consider bringing layers, as temperatures can change throughout the day. Pack sunscreen, even in cooler months, due to the regionβs high UV index.
